Port-Au-Prince, Haiti- October 12, 2005- Dr. Joel Borgella, Founder of Radio Tropicale International and a very well-respected OB-GYN, is running for President of the Republic of Haiti under the slogan: Let�s create a Haiti hospitable to all; the poor, the rich as well as the Diaspora. The Year 2004, albeit a Jubilee Year, was an annum miserabilis for the Republic of Haiti. A violent transfer of government in February was followed by a deadly mudslide in May, hurricanes and floods in September, killing some five thousand people. The Year 2005 is a watershed year for Haiti. The Haitian people will go to the polls not only to elect a new President but also to elect legislators, senators, mayors and rural county leaders on November 20th and December 15th 2005 (tentative). The Republic of Haiti can continue on the path of squalor that has been its lot for the past fifty years or it can stride forward into a bold new direction. Creating a new culture and a new policy that is welcoming to all, in particular to those who have been marginalized in the rural regions and in the urban slums. Dr. Joel Borgella, a medical doctor by profession, has served his community for the past 16 years in many ways. Notably by founding, funding and running Radio Tropicale in New York, the Haitian communities premiere radio station linking the two million Haitians in the Diaspora with the eight million citizens in Haiti. He has also built and sponsored schools and a hospital for the poor in Haiti. OLAHH also distributed medical supplies as well as food and other goods, after Hurricane Jeanne ravaged several towns in Haiti last year. In order to do so, he intends to implement a number of initiatives that will tangibly improve the lives of his country�s citizens. As President, Dr. Joel Borgella will first address the needs of the rural regions of Haiti. The OLAHH government will carry out the projects outlined in the Plan of Government that will bring roads, schools, water and electricity to the millions of country dwellers who have suffered governmental neglect for the past two hundred years. Second, his administration plans to make of Haiti, with the support of its Diaspora and the international community, a vast construction site, building ports, airports, telecommunications, and dams, all the infrastructures, which are needed to modernize the country�s economy and basic way of life. Thirdly, a Borgella administration will strive to overthrow the culture of corruption and chronic lack of public spirit in Haiti in order to bring to the population much needed services in the areas of security, education, health, agriculture, housing, tourism, and art promotion. As President, Dr. Borgella will boost the Haitian budget through innovative features such as his �Debt Swapping for Nature� proposal to rebuild the ravaged environment and the �Millennium Challenge Grant� to combat corruption and bring in good governance so as to foster democracy, peace, and prosperity in our country.
